This is a routine update to the latest upstream version, 0.17.2. Changes since 0.15.0-4 ---------------------- pkg-config 0.17.2 - Don't go into an infinite loop allocating more and more memory when the same name is specified twice on the command line and we're in "direct dependencies only"-mode. pkg-config 0.17.1 - Now actually sets CFLAGS and LIBS instead of trying to set those in a subshell. (Only affects if you've autoreconfiscated with 0.17) - Fix detection of inter-library dependencies. pkg-config 0.17 - Evaluate second argument to PKG_CHECK_MODULES again - Portability fixes (MacOS, BeOS, Cygwin) - Handle inter-library dependencies and assume those are in place if the platform supports them. Disable with --enable-indirect-deps. - Add initial test framework - Build fixes (make distcheck now works) pkg-config 0.16 - Use a search path, rather than a single default directory. - Fix a bunch of bugs in glib by backporting - More man page fixes - Lots of small fixes and cleanups over the place. --Chuck To update your installation, click on the "Install Cygwin now" link on the http://cygwin.com/ web page.
